The Part of the Libero
The libero is a defensive specialist, largely liable for obtaining serves and digging assaults in the opposing crew. Their most important occupation is to help keep the ball off the floor and provide precise passes into the setter, making chances for prosperous offensive performs. Due to this, liberos will have to have fantastic reflexes, court docket consciousness, and passing techniques.
Compared with other gamers, the libero is restricted from executing specific actions. They can't attack the ball higher than the height of the net, cannot serve (in certain leagues, while this rule is evolving), and cannot block or try and block. Furthermore, they are able to only play from the back row and so are not permitted to rotate in to the entrance row positions.
Unique Regulations for Liberos
To balance their specialized job, liberos stick to a unique list of substitution rules:
Limitless Substitutions: Liberos can enter and exit the game freely, devoid of counting towards the workforce’s substitution Restrict, but they are able to only exchange a back again-row player.
Jersey Contrast: Liberos should use a unique-colored jersey to get quickly identifiable by referees and spectators.
Setter Limitation: If a libero sets the ball applying an overhand finger go when in front of the assault line (The three-meter line), any attack produced over The online on that established is prohibited.
These policies are created to Restrict the libero’s offensive impression when maximizing their defensive contributions.
Why the Libero Placement Issues
The libero was introduced to enhance the caliber of defensive play and allow for lengthier, more enjoyable rallies. Just before this posture existed, tall and strong hitters often dominated the game, and defense was generally overshadowed. The libero brought balance by putting a high quality on ball control and finesse.
A talented libero can totally change the momentum of a recreation. Their capacity to read the hitter, foresee performs, and supply fantastic passes can turn tough defensive scenarios into scoring chances. Teams with sturdy liberos typically delight in superior serve-receive formations and much more constant transitions between protection and offense.
